🎄🔥 A VERY MERHI CHRISTMAS 🔥🎄For our Christmas episode, The PM Entertainment Podcast dives headfirst into Riot (1996) — a Yuletide action spectacular where Gary Daniels roundhouse kicks his way through idiot children who don't know how to cook a pizza and have terrible taste in wall art, civil unrest, and unusually agressive amateur sports teams, through a Los Angeles riot zone that is suspiciously the New York backlot at Paramount Studios, lit only by burning cars and twinkly Christmas lights that turn out to have a suspiciously high voltage - it's a slamming seasonal smashfest like only PM could deliver.Teaming up with Sugar Ray Leonard, and backed by B Movie, character actor, legend Charles Napier, the Britkicker himself has to deal with multiple mad gangs, the IRA and an insane amount of rocket launcher chaos, all under the watchful eye of relentless investigative reporter Harry Johansen. The result is a breathless, nonstop display of stunt carnage and dodgy accents orchestrated by Spiro Razatos and Director, Joseph Merhi. Peace on Earth was never an option.Joining us for the breakdown are Chris Kacvinsky from Bulletproof Action and Matt Poirier the Direct-to-Video Connoisseur, whose new novel Mark in Sales is available NOW on Amazon:https://amzn.to/3Y9NrFT buy it today!Together, we dig into why Riot remains one of PM’s most ambitious action outings, idiot pizza box burning children, the film’s massive stunt work, and imagine many a Harry Johansen, collective PM Universe, spin-off.And that’s not all — this episode is packed with interviews, including:🎤 William Applegate Jr., the screenwriter🎤 Kenneth Tigar, reflecting on his role as Harry Johansen, PM’s most fearless on-screen reporter and L.A.
